GREAT AND MIGHTY THINGS INC, founded in 2014, is a micro nonprofit in the Human Services sector that reported $70K in total revenue in fiscal year 2018. Revenue fell 22%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ring. The organization ran a surplus of $50K, a strong 71% operating margin.

Mission

PROVIDE FUNDING TO LOCAL CHURCHES AND CHARITABLE ORGANIZATIONS TO ASSIST WITH EMERGENCIES, DISASTER RELIEF AND COMMUNITY NEEDS.
